SP Refractories Limited (NSE:SPRL)
India flag India · Delayed Price · Currency is INR
130.50
+6.10 (4.90%)
At close: Sep 26, 2025

SP Refractories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 20212019 - 2020
Period Ending
Sep '25 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2019 - 2020
245215260143151-
Upgrade
Market Cap Growth
55.40%-17.50%81.81%-5.33%--
Upgrade
Enterprise Value
289253312205191-
Upgrade
Last Close Price
136.75120.00145.4580.0084.50-
Upgrade
PE Ratio
11.7110.2716.7023.2515.36-
Upgrade
PS Ratio
0.810.710.900.530.48-
Upgrade
PB Ratio
1.941.712.481.601.82-
Upgrade
P/TBV Ratio
1.941.712.481.601.82-
Upgrade
P/FCF Ratio
22.0619.3659.75---
Upgrade
P/OCF Ratio
16.3414.3416.4235.0118.88-
Upgrade
EV/Sales Ratio
0.960.841.080.750.61-
Upgrade
EV/EBITDA Ratio
8.197.1610.7813.849.58-
Upgrade
EV/EBIT Ratio
9.238.0812.1516.5710.80-
Upgrade
EV/FCF Ratio
26.0622.8171.70---
Upgrade
Debt / Equity Ratio
0.350.350.450.610.610.81
Upgrade
Debt / EBITDA Ratio
1.261.261.613.662.552.58
Upgrade
Debt / FCF Ratio
4.004.0010.73---
Upgrade
Asset Turnover
1.681.681.731.742.442.63
Upgrade
Inventory Turnover
4.644.646.507.9012.4014.39
Upgrade
Quick Ratio
1.321.321.441.211.201.25
Upgrade
Current Ratio
2.422.422.221.921.811.54
Upgrade
Return on Equity (ROE)
18.11%18.11%16.04%7.13%15.15%17.55%
Upgrade
Return on Assets (ROA)
10.87%10.87%9.67%4.93%8.54%7.86%
Upgrade
Return on Capital (ROIC)
12.16%12.16%10.88%5.57%10.10%9.31%
Upgrade
Return on Capital Employed (ROCE)
22.30%22.30%20.30%11.20%18.50%24.60%
Upgrade
Earnings Yield
8.54%9.74%5.99%4.30%6.51%-
Upgrade
FCF Yield
4.53%5.17%1.67%-9.28%-15.43%-
Upgrade
Buyback Yield / Dilution
-0.02%-0.02%--19.30%10.71%-12.60%
Upgrade
Updated Mar 31,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.